What we believe
ABOUT GOD
God is the Creator and Ruler of the universe.
He has eternally existed in three persons: the
Father, the Son and the Holy Spirit. These three
are co-equal and are one God.
Genesis 1:1,26,27; 3:22; Psalm 90:2; Matthew
28:19; 1 Peter 1:2; 2 Corinthians 13:14
ABOUT
MAN
Man is made in the spiritual image of God, to
be like Him in character. He is the supreme
object of Gods creation. Although man has tremendous
potential for good, he is marred by an attitude
of disobedience toward God called "sin".
This attitude separates man from God.
Genesis 1:27; Psalm 8:3-6; Isaiah 53:6a; Romans
3:23; Isaiah 59:1,2
ABOUT
ETERNITY
Man was created to exist forever. He will either
exist eternally separated from God by sin, or
in union with God through forgiveness and salvation.
To be eternally separated from God is Hell.
To be eternally in union with Him is eternal
life. Heaven and Hell are places of eternal
existence.
John 3:16; John 2:25; John 5:11-13; Romans 6:23;
Revelation 20:15; 1 John 5:11-12; Matthew 25:31-46
ABOUT
JESUS CHRIST
Jesus Christ is the Son of God. He is co-equal
with the Father. Jesus lived a sinless human
life and offered Himself as the perfect sacrifice
for the sins of all men by dying on a cross.
He arose from the dead after three days to demonstrate
His power over sin and death. He ascended to
Heavens glory and will return again to earth
to reign as King of kings, and Lord of lords.
Matthew 1:22,23; Isaiah 9:6; John 1:1-5, 14:10-30;
Hebrews 4:14,15; 1 Corinthians 15:3,4; Romans
1:3,4; Acts 1:9-11; 1 Timothy 6:14,15; Titus
2:13
ABOUT
SALVATION
Salvation is a gift from God to man. Man can
never make up for his sin by self-improvement
or good works. Only by trusting in Jesus Christ
as Gods offer of forgiveness can man be saved
from sins’ penalty. Eternal life begins
the moment one receives Jesus Christ into his
life by faith.
Romans 6:23; Ephesians 2:8,9; John 14:6, 1:12;
Titus 3:5; Galatians 3:26; Romans 5:1
ABOUT
ETERNAL SECURITY
Because God gives man eternal life through Jesus
Christ, the believer is secure in salvation
for eternity. Salvation is maintained by the
grace and power of God, not by the self-effort
of the Christian. It is the grace and keeping
power of God that gives this security.
John 10:29; 2 Timothy 1:12; Hebrews 7:25; 10:10,14;
1 Peter 1:3-5
ABOUT
THE HOLY SPIRIT
The Holy Spirit is equal with the Father and
the Son as God. He is present in the world to
make men aware of their need for Jesus Christ.
He also lives in every Christian from the moment
of salvation. He provides the Christian with
power for living, understanding of spiritual
truth, and guidance in doing what is right.
The Christian seeks to live under His control
daily.
2 Corinthians 3:17; John 16:7-13, 14:16,17;
Acts 1:8; 1 Corinthians 2:12, 3:16; Ephesians
1:13; Galatians 5:25; Ephesians 5:1
ABOUT
THE BIBLE
The Bible is Gods word to all men. It was written
by human authors, under the supernatural guidance
of the Holy Spirit. It is the supreme source
of truth for Christian beliefs and living. Because
it is inspired by God, it is truth without any
mixture of error.
2 Timothy 3:16; 2 Peter 1:20,21; 2 Timothy 1:13;
Psalm 119:105,160, 12:6; Proverbs 30:5)
